The College approaches its commitment to educational opportunity by maintaining an open admission policy in accordance with State Board requirements and by charging low tuition fees. The College also assists students in obtaining financial support. Residence hall facilities are provided for students at the Wadley Campus. Effort is made to provide and to schedule courses for the convenience of students. Day and evening courses are offered at every campus to provide maximum educational opportunity to the community, and some offerings are available on the weekends.

Student personnel services are provided by the College to support the educational programs and to assist in the development of the students enrolled. Among the activities carried out by Student Personnel Services are placement testing and orientation for entering freshmen and transfer students, academic consultation, coordination and supervision of student activities, and student assistance for placement and transfer activities.
